Belonging
- Natural Histories of Place, Identity and Home
- By: Amanda Thomson
- Narrated by: Lois Chimimba
- Length: 7 hrs and 37 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all
-
Performance
-
Story
Reflecting on family, identity and nature, Belonging is a personal memoir about what it is to have and make a home. It is a love letter to nature, especially the northern landscapes of Scotland and the Scots pinewoods of Abernethy—home to standing dead trees known as snags, which support the overall health of the forest. Belonging is a book about how we are held in thrall to elements of our past. It speaks to the importance of attention and reflection, and will encourage us all to look and observe and ask questions of ourselves.

Past Is Prologue
- How memory shapes our decisions, actions and identities
- By: Dr Daphna Shohamy
- Length: 8 hrs and 32 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all
-
Performance
-
Story
World-leading scientist Dr. Daphna Shohamy studies memories and following over 20 years of expert research in neuroscience and psychology, presents an entirely new understanding of the role of memory, arguing that its primary purpose isn’t to accurately remember the past, but rather to help us predict the future, shape behaviour, and influence the people we become. In this ground-breaking book, Shohamy explores how memory works, analyses the science of decision-making and reveals how understanding memory can shed light on a myriad of societal issues.

Rather than thinking of memory as a hard drive on our computer, holding a record of past events in endless files, we should think of memory as a compass, a behaviour whisperer, serving up a general sense of what we have learned in a way that is most relevant to decisions we are facing right now.
